Rook Ceph Multi-Node
Production Rook Ceph deployment with high availability across multiple nodes.
Design
- 3+ nodes for high availability
- Dedicated disks on each node for Ceph OSDs
- mon.count: 3, mgr.count: 2
- Pool replication size: 3
- Failure domain: host (survives node failure)
Prerequisites
- Kubernetes 1.30+
- 3+ nodes with dedicated raw disks
- Each node labeled for Ceph:
kubectl label node <name> ceph-node=true
Quick Install
# Add Rook Helm repo
helm repo add rook-release https://charts.rook.io/release
helm repo update
# Install operator
helm install --create-namespace --namespace rook-ceph \
rook-ceph rook-release/rook-ceph
# Wait for operator
kubectl -n rook-ceph wait --for=condition=ready pod -l app=rook-ceph-operator --timeout=300s
# Install cluster (use values from references/cluster-values.md)
helm install --namespace rook-ceph rook-ceph-cluster \
--set operatorNamespace=rook-ceph \
rook-release/rook-ceph-cluster -f cluster-values.yaml
Verify Installation
# Check pods (expect 3 mons, 2 mgrs, OSDs per disk)
kubectl -n rook-ceph get pods -o wide
# Check cluster status
kubectl -n rook-ceph get cephcluster
# Ceph health (should be HEALTH_OK)
kubectl -n rook-ceph exec -it deploy/rook-ceph-tools -- ceph status
kubectl -n rook-ceph exec -it deploy/rook-ceph-tools -- ceph osd tree
Storage Classes
Created automatically by Helm. Verify with:
kubectl get sc
Default classes: ceph-block (RBD), ceph-filesystem (CephFS)
Scaling
Add OSD (new disk)
Update cephClusterSpec.storage.nodes in values and upgrade Helm release.
Add Node
- Label node:
kubectl label node <name> ceph-node=true - Add to
storage.nodesin values - Helm upgrade
Troubleshooting
# Cluster health
kubectl -n rook-ceph exec -it deploy/rook-ceph-tools -- ceph health detail
# OSD status
kubectl -n rook-ceph exec -it deploy/rook-ceph-tools -- ceph osd status
# Pool status
kubectl -n rook-ceph exec -it deploy/rook-ceph-tools -- ceph df
# PG status (placement groups)
kubectl -n rook-ceph exec -it deploy/rook-ceph-tools -- ceph pg stat
